How to be more concise when describing your music

Posted: Sep 27, 2021

Category: The Musician Business

promotion online presence concise know your audience major artists electronic musician

**Guest post by Electronic Musician.

 

"Can you describe your music in 6 words or less? It's the first question that anyone asks you about your music: What kind of music do you make? Your answer to that question is the most important thing. It’s even more important than your story. So don’t wing it. You should prepare it ahead of time and have it at the tip of your tongue when interviewers, the media, and people you meet ask. Don't try to make a perfect and complete description: the goal is to get them curious enough to ask to want to hear your music. That's how you'll know if you've created the right description. Here are some simple ideas to help you describe your music effectively..."

Looking for a Champion

Posted: Apr 19, 2021

Category: The Musician Business

music business keys to success dave grohl helping artists major artists champion hard work clark colborn jimi hendrix van halen kiss

**Guest post by Clark Colborn, progressive hard rock guitarist.

 

Clark Colborn


"Lately I have been studying the paths that successful bands and solo musicians have followed to get to the pinnacle of their careers, thinking that if I understand what worked for them then maybe I can create a similar path for myself...the goal in researching these musicians is to find out how they were introduced to that larger audience, and I have discovered there are two main factors that every single one of these artists has in common."

Recording At Home: Taking A Song From Demo To #1

Posted: Sep 26, 2016

Category: Recording

clay mills diy recording gear major artists publisher recording songtown songwriting

**Guest post written by Clay Mills, hit songwriter, producer, performer, and founder of SongTown.com.

 

Recording At Home Clay Mills
"People often ask me if they have to do full-production demos to present songs to publishers or major artists? I do a fair amount of full demos, but I also have had about half of my major cuts from pitching home demos done on a very basic set-up on my mac laptop..."
